    Note Welcome to GroupDocs.Classification for .NET GroupDocs.Classification is a .NET compOnent built to allow developers to classify texts and documents, whether simple or complex. It allows developers to use three different taxonomies: IAB (version 2), that created by the Interactive Advertising Bureau, Documents taxonomy, that created by Aspose and simple Sentiment taxonomy (Negative/Positive). For the Sentiment taxonomy Chinese language is supported.     We are pleased to announce GroupDocs.Merger for .NET 18.5. A back-end document manipulation API that allows to split, remove or reorder pages in a document of supported format. Pages could be swapped or trimmed. You can also manage documents protection. GroupDocs.Merger for .NET allows to check document protection and then set, remove or update password.
